Gluten Free, Egg Free, Dairy Free, Soy Free, Peanut Free, and Nut Free *For Gluten Free option see end note
This brownie recipe has a similar taste to dark chocolate. It has half the sugar than most brownie recipes but it doesn’t need it. It’s got plenty of yummyness from the cocoa and semi-sweet chocolate chips. Top with your favorite dairy free ice-cream and it’s a perfect allergy free brownie sundae!
Ingredients
- • 1/2 cup dairy free margarine
- • 1 cups of semi-sweet chocolate chips
- • 2 tbsp ground flaxseed
- • 6 tbsp water
- • 1/2 cup of cocoa powder
- • ¾ cup all purpose flour or gluten free all purpose flour*
- • 1 tsp baking powder
- • ¼ tsp salt
- • ½ cup of granulated sugar
- •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- • 1/4 cup of applesauce
- • If using gluten free all purpose flour, add 1/4 tsp xanthum gum or guar guar gum
Gluten Free Option
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ease a 8×8-in pan.
- In a small sauce pan melt the margarine & chocolate chips.
- In a small bowl combine flaxseed and hot water and let sit for 5 minutes to thicken.
- In a large bowl mix unsweetened cocoa powder, sugar, flour, baking powder, and salt together.
- Add in applesauce, vanilla, flaxseed mixture and melted chocolate.
- Pour into the pan.
- Bake for 20 to 25 minutes.
- Allow to cool thoroughly and cut into squares.
